Prostate Cancer Screening Recommendations

In light of the limitations of evidence regarding prostate cancer screening, it is important to consider the natural history of this disease and subgroups of men at high risk for developing prostate cancer.  These considerations are critical for determining public health policy.  Men’s preferences regarding testing vary, and these preferences also are important in deciding on screening.  Most medical organizations now stress the importance of individualizing screening decisions based on factors such as patient’s preference, health history, and health status.
